1. A scalable call processing node for receiving SS7 messages and for formulating media-gateway-compatible messages, the scalable node comprising:
- (a) a plurality of link interface modules (LIMs) for receiving SS7 messages over SS7 signaling links and performing call server selection based on first message parameters in the SS7 messages, the link interface modules being capable of processing SS7 messages for at least about n calls per second, n being an integer;
(b) a plurality of call server modules operatively associated with the link interface modules for receiving the SS7 messages from the link interface modules based on the call server selection and for performing call setup operations for setting up connections in media gateways, the call server modules being capable of setting up at least about m calls per second, m being an integer, wherein n is variable relative to m by changing the relative numbers of link interface and call server modules; and
(c) a plurality of transporter modules operatively associated with the call server modules for formulating media-gateway-compatible messages based on the call setup operations, and for forwarding the media-gateway-compatible messages to media gateways.

Abstract
A scalable call processing node includes link interface modules capable of processing n calls per second and call server modules capable of processing m calls per second, n is variable relative to m by changing the relative numbers of call server and link interface modules. In addition, call server modules can perform subsecond switchover when a call server fails without requiring inter-call server transfer of call state information.
